There are only a few days left to take advantage of the discounted tickets for the biggest Catholic Youth Event in the country takes place at Wembley Arena, on Saturday 4th March 2023.  All young people in school year 9 or above, attached to your parish, school or university are WELCOME!

Artists at Flame now include One Hope Project’ Adeniké who was a semi-finalist in the 2020 series of the Voice under mentor and coach WILL.I.AM Faith Child and Cardinal Tagle a very inspirational speaker from the Philippines.

To join our Diocesan group, get your tickets, hoodies and transportation from Portsmouth Cathedral or for more information about the event please contact youth@portsmouthdiocese.org.uk.
